Getting There

  • Walking

    If you are already in Gellért Hill, you can easily walk to the summit. From the Gellért Baths, head up the steps to the Gellért Hill path. Follow the path as it winds up the hill, taking in the beautiful views of the Danube River and the city along the way. The walk takes about 15-20 minutes and is mostly uphill. The path is well-marked and there are several resting spots to enjoy the scenery.

  • Public Transport

    If you are further away in Budapest, take Tram 19 or 41 towards the Gellért Hill stop. The fare is approximately 350 HUF (about 1 EUR) for a single journey, which you can purchase at ticket machines or kiosks at the tram station. Once you get off at Gellért Hill, walk towards the Gellért Baths and then follow the same walking path mentioned above to reach the summit.

Discover more about Gellért hill

Gellért Hill is one of Budapest's most iconic landmarks, celebrated for its stunning panoramic views of the city and its historical significance. Rising majestically from the banks of the Danube, this hill offers visitors a chance to explore its rich cultural heritage while enjoying the tranquility of nature. The ascent to the top is rewarded with breathtaking vistas that showcase the vibrant cityscape, including the majestic Parliament building, the historic Buda Castle, and the winding river below. The hill is also home to several monuments, including the Liberty Statue, which commemorates the liberation of Hungary during World War II, making it not just a beautiful location but also a poignant reminder of the city’s tumultuous past. As you wander along the paths of Gellért Hill, you will encounter lush greenery, flowering trees, and peaceful nooks perfect for a moment of reflection or a scenic picnic. The area is well-maintained, with various viewpoints that cater to photographers and nature enthusiasts alike. Additionally, the nearby Gellért Thermal Baths invite visitors to experience the healing waters that Budapest is famous for, completing the perfect day of exploration and relaxation. Whether you choose to hike to the summit or take a leisurely stroll along the lower trails, Gellért Hill promises a delightful experience that combines history, nature, and stunning views.
